Rating: 5 stars
Summary: Excellent Read
Review: Out shopping for a gift for a friend's birthday, I came across this slim purple text. Perfect, I thought, for a gift. Upon opening it this book I fell in love with the simplicity and the gorgeous illustrations. Although colorful, this is not merely a coffee table book for display. It is a compact and uselful book. The information in this book is interesting, set off by the magical illustrations. However, the plants presented are not your everyday garden variety! An intersting and beautiful book. By the way, there was only one copy, so I bought it for myself...
